About The Position

The responsibilities of the HVAC helper include performing routine maintenance, replacing parts, repairing machinery, and furnishing the HVAC technicians with tools, materials, and supplies. To be successful as an HVAC helper, you should be familiar with HVAC systems as well as the tools related to the installation, maintenance, and repair of these systems. Ultimately, a top-notch HVAC helper should be physically fit, good with their hands, and able to effectively follow instructions.

Responsibilities

  • Assisting with the installation of HVAC systems on commercial and residential properties.
  • Installing, maintaining, and repairing roof units for heating and air conditioning as well as the units inside residential and commercial buildings.
  • Operating a variety of hand and power tools needed for HVAC installation.
  • Cleaning and replacing air ducts.
  • Following instructions for picking up and delivering parts, tools, materials, and supplies to and from the job site.
  • Ensuring all tools, materials, and equipment are in good working order.
  • Completing preventative maintenance on HVAC systems and the associated equipment.
  • Maintaining, troubleshooting, repairing, and replacing plumbing and electrical systems.
  • Coordinating with team members to provide excellent customer service.
  • Ensuring all HVAC systems remain compliant with industry standards and regulations.
